    Well I got alot done on the layout today but not too many photos.I got 90% of the track down so I decided to do a little test running.I plug up the DCC and boom I have a short.I worked on it for 3 hours this morning until I realized it was my new "METAL" track bumper that I didnt isolate.What an idiot I am.So I got the track work running good so I went back to my first area of scenery and decided to do a little detail work.Here is the are I worked on.

    [​IMG]
    I wanted to do a few things so I added the safety stripes on the truck bumpers on the building.Next I added some rust chalk to the building but not too much as this is a fairly new building on the N&E.I also added a little dirt chalk to the bottom of the building.Next I added some weeds to the edge of the building and also some ivy to the BLMA fence.I also dusted in some grass on the spur but not too much as their will be alot of car swapping at PFG warehouse.I still have to add the sign to the building but that will be later.I would also like to add more detail to the construction scene but that will be later as well.Here is a photo of the area after the work was done.Enjoy...
    [​IMG]

    The glue was still wet when I shot the photos.

    Tonight I got some more scenery done but the glue was wet so I didnt get any pictures.While the glue was drying I decided to get one of my new shiny boxcars and do some decals and weathering.Here is a photo of the boxcar out of the box;
    [​IMG]

    I took some Micro-scale graffiti decals and applied them and hit it with some dull-coat.I then applied some Bragdon Enterprise chalks and brushed on different dirts and rust and now have a boxcar that will be allowed on the layout.Here is the finished look.
    [​IMG]


    What a difference 30 minutes makes to the plastic look.All for now.
